Indicators
Operating Cash Flow
2.51B
Net Income
4.11B
Mixed Signal
0.61
Cash flow is meaningfully below reported profit. Some gap is normal, but a persistent gap warrants questioning of the accounting.
Most investors only look at net income, which companies can manipulate through accounting rules. Cash flow is harder to fake. A ratio above 1.0 means every dollar of profit is backed by real cash.
